Acalabrutinib (ACP-196) is an orally active, irreversible, and highly selective second-generation BTK inhibitor. Acalabrutinib binds covalently to Cys481 in the ATP-binding pocket of BTK. Acalabrutinib demonstrates potent on-target effects and efficacy in mouse models of chronic lymphocytic leukemia (CLL). Acalabrutinib can be used for CLL research . Acalabrutinib is a click chemistry reagent, itcontains an Alkyne group and can undergo copper-catalyzed azide-alkyne cycloaddition (CuAAc) with molecules containing Azide groups.

Pimavanserin is a selective, brain-penetrant, inverse agonist of the 5-HT2A receptor with pIC50 and pKd of 8.73 and 9.3, respectively.

ACP-105 is an orally available, selective amd potent androgen receptor modulator (SARM), with pEC50s of 9.0 and 9.3 for AR wild type and T877A mutant, respectively.

Diethyl phthalate is an orally active plasticizer and detergent base. Diethyl phthalate increases the activities of ACP, ALP, SDH, and ALT in liver, muscle, or both tissues. Diethyl phthalate induces dose-dependent mortality and sluggish behavior in freshwater fish. Diethyl phthalate may induce male reproductive toxicity. Diethyl phthalate is added to plastic polymers to help maintain their flexibility .

ACP-5862 is a major active, circulating, pyrrolidine ring-opened metabolite of Acalabrutinib with an IC50 of 5.0 nM for Bruton tyrosine kinase (BTK). ACP‐5862 is a weak time‐dependent inactivator of CYP3A4 and CYP2C8. Acalabrutinib is an orally active, irreversible, and highly selective BTK inhibitor, with an IC50 of 3 nM and EC50 of 8 nM .

OncoACP3 TFA is a small-molecule ligand of prostatic acid phosphatase (ACP3) with an IC50 of 0.30 nM. OncoACP3 TFA has a modular structure that supports flexible payload delivery. After radiolabeling with Lu-177 it selectively accumulates in ACP3-expressing tumors with a long retention time, enabling targeted radiation delivery. OncoACP3 TFA is applicable to research related to prostate cancer .

Acyl Carrier Protein (ACP) (65-74) is a key coenzyme fragment of fatty acid synthase (FAS) and participates in fatty acid synthesis as an acyl carrier. Acyl Carrier Protein (ACP) (65-74) mediates condensation, reduction and other cyclic reactions in fatty acid synthesis by covalently binding to acyl chains to form acyl-ACP intermediates, promoting acyl chain extension. Acyl Carrier Protein (ACP) (65-74) can regulate the synthesis ratio of saturated and unsaturated fatty acids. Acyl Carrier Protein (ACP) (65-74) can be used to study the mechanism of bacterial fatty acid synthesis and is a potential target for antibiotics (such as inhibiting the FAS system of pathogens) .

Trimyristin is an orally active compound. Trimyristin can be isolated from the seeds of nutmeg (Myristica fragrans). Trimyristin inhibits the activities of acetylcholinesterase (AChE), ACP and ALP, with IC50 values of 0.11, 0.16 and 0.18 mM, respectively. Trimyristin exerts competitive-noncompetitive inhibition on acetylcholinesterase, uncompetitive inhibition on ACP, and competitive/noncompetitive inhibition on ALP. Trimyristin restores the downregulated acetylcholinesterase concentration in the cerebral cortex of rats exposed to sodium arsenite. Trimyristin can be used in studies related to fascioliasis and neurotoxicity .

QP5 is an Amelogenin (HY-P71627)-derived peptide. QP5 binds to hydroxyapatite and demineralized enamel surfaces, temporarily stabilizes amorphous calcium phosphate (ACP), and regulates the crystallization of hydroxyapatite. QP5 promotes remineralization of artificial enamel caries in vitro, and acts synergistically with fluoride to enhance enamel caries remineralization. QP5 can be used in studies related to enamel caries and early enamel caries .

Diazaborine is an inhibitor for enoyl-acyl carrier protein (enoyl ACP) in an NAD+-dependent manner. Diazaborine exhibits antibacterial activity, MIC for E. coli and K. pneumoniae is 25 and 3.12 μg/mL .
